...They are the descendants of the people who founded the Angkor Dynasty. They call themselves Kampucheans or Kumaeans, and outside of Cambodia, about one million people (who call themselves Kampucheans) live in the Mekong Delta region of southern Vietnam, and about two million people live in the Korat Plateau and Moon River basin in Thailand. Their cradle is said to be in the mid-Mekong region, and they adopted Indian culture early on and formed a nation. *Some of the terminology that refers to "Kampucheans" is listed below.
